blob: a8620843e1b53e26942d95b41fa2626926694619 (
plain)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
|
From: Ruben Undheim <ruben.undheim@gmail.com>
Date: Sat, 14 May 2016 15:44:13 +0200
Subject: The dependency abc is built with the name yosys-abc upstream. Since
it is available as a separate package independently of yosys,
it is not called yosys-abc in debian. This patch changes the name of the
command that yosys looks for.
Forwarded: doesn't make sense upstream
---
passes/techmap/abc.cc |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
diff --git a/passes/techmap/abc.cc b/passes/techmap/abc.cc
index 7da2660..8b35d43 100644
--- a/passes/techmap/abc.cc
+++ b/passes/techmap/abc.cc
@@ -1289,7 +1289,7 @@ struct AbcPass : public Pass {
log_header("Executing ABC pass (technology mapping using ABC).\n");
log_push();
- std::string exe_file = proc_self_dirname() + "yosys-abc";
+ std::string exe_file = "berkeley-abc";
std::string script_file, liberty_file, constr_file, clk_str, delay_target;
bool fast_mode = false, dff_mode = false, keepff = false, cleanup = true;
bool show_tempdir = false;
|